About Rick Frank

Rick is a criminal defence lawyer who passionately represents his clients, and he is an essential component to each file at the firm. He has worked on cases ranging from theft and assault, to murder and dangerous offender hearings. He approaches each case with a critical eye, creative argument, and defends each case rigorously.

Rick attended Osgoode Hall Law School, where he focused on criminal law. During law school, he was an executive director of Fair Change Community Services, a legal clinic that provides pro bono legal services to street-involved persons charged with provincial offences. Upon graduation, he received the Dean's Gold Key award for his outstanding contribution to the Osgoode community. Rick articled with a leading criminal defence firm in Toronto, where he worked alongside and learned from some of Canada’s top lawyers. There, he gained experience including defending large-scale fraud and criminal organization allegations, regulatory offences, and professional discipline allegations. Rick is called to the bar in Ontario and is a board member of Fair Change Community Services.
